Today, Roxboro Community School (RCS) high school Principal Darkarai Bryant honored teachers Ashley Bailey and Amanda Carter with certificates for Excellence in Teaching. Bryant said the state of North Carolina recognizes teachers in certain End-of-Grade (EOG) and Advanced Placement (AP) tested subjects. It does not, however, recognize End-of-Course (EOC) tested subjects. RCS wanted to recognize Bailey and Carter for their efforts. Both teachers' students exceeded growth according to EVAAS, (Education Value Added Assessment System) which means the students had more than a year's growth in the subject area. So, said Bryant, "we wanted to recognize Mrs. Bailey for Excellence in Teaching Biology and Mrs. Carter for Excellence in Teaching Math III. Both are to be commended for their dedication to their students."
